Surviving the Lagoon
Originally released in 2018. Surviving the Lagoon is a documentary film. directed by Manuel Lefèvre. At just 52 minutes, it's a tight, focused story.
Synopsis
In the heart of the a vast ocean, the atolls of the Pacific are like oasis in a sprawling desert. Each one contains a unique and breathtaking environment. Where the reef breaks, the ecosystem of the lagoon flourishes. Filmed in UHD and extreme slow motion, this film captures the exclusive behavior of the creatures that live here, including sharks, whales, manta rays, groupers, and many more.
